自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

爱码农爱生活

公众号:爱码农爱生活 ,有遇到不明白的,欢迎留言一起讨论

  • 博客(1792)
  • 资源 (6)
  • 问答 (1)
  • 收藏
  • 关注

原创 为什么要监控sql语句,以及如何监控,都有哪几种方式可以监控。

快速阅读为什么要监控sql语句,以及如何监控,都有哪几种方式可以监控。我们知道sql server 中有个工具叫sql profile ,可以实时监控sql server中 执行的sql 语句,以方便调试bug 或者确认最终生成的sql语句为什么要监控sql语句?因为程序大了以后,sql语句有可能被多个地方调用 。你不能确认当前时间是不是只执行了你需要的那条语句 。有的持久层框架采用l...

2019-07-28 00:03:45 4553 1

原创 关于hexo与github使用过程中的问题与笔记

关于hexo与github使用过程中的问题与笔记快速阅读如何用github 和hexo 创建一个blog1.github中要新建一个与用户名同一样的仓库, 如:homehe.github.io- 必须是io后缀。一个帐户 只能建立一个2. 绑定域名 , A记录指向ip, cname记录指向homehe.github.io3. 配置sshkey- 个人设置 -> SSH ...

2019-07-27 00:00:21 197

原创 IIS错误代码500.21 ,Nhibernate更新报错,委托的使用。action传参数

快速阅读IIS错误代码500.21 ,Nhibernate更新报错,委托的使用。action传参数IIS错误代码500.21HTTP 错误 500.21 - Internal Server Error处理程序“PageHandlerFactory-Integrated”在其模块列表中有一个错误模块“ManagedPipelineHandler”原因是,当前程序需要注册一下aspnet 4...

2019-07-25 23:39:36 159

原创 mysql 使用的三个小技巧

快速阅读Mysql查询工具中如何查询多条语名,Mysql中如何设置变量,Mysql中如何查特定字段,后面再加*Mysql查询工具中如何查询多条语名默认myslq只能查询一条语句,如果想查询多条,可以在各条之间加;号select * from tbl_A;select * from tbl_BMysql中如何设置变量用set语句,SET @dt = DATE_ADD(NOW(), ...

2019-07-24 23:38:33 105

原创 利用反向代理服务器,加快国内对国外主机的访问

快速阅读利用反向代理服务器,加快国内对国外主机的访问。国外服务器如何让访问速度变快。国内因为域名要备案,而备案比较麻烦,所以好多人直接买好域名以后,用的是国外的服务器,可以直接建站。但是国外的服务器有个麻烦之外就是国内访问速度太慢。所以有必要设置一个反向代理,增加文章 。国外服务器用域名访问,环境是lnmp的环境 ,在域名配置文件中。增加反向代理 ,地址指向国内的服务器。通过ip访问...

2019-07-23 23:19:50 876

原创 2019年七月第三周总结

快速阅读回顾本周对于Tuxedo中间件,welloigc中间件使用的调查 ,以及系统设计时如何画时序图,数据流图,ERD图最后介绍一个事件的使用MenualResetEventTuxedo是oracle推出的一个中间件服务, 采用Tuxedo协议进行通讯,主要用于金融,电信,制造行业中。主要作用是使系统各部门可以相互操作,最大限度的节省系统资源,提高系统性能。也可以参考:https:...

2019-07-22 23:36:31 91

原创 ManualResetEven使用的最清楚说明

快速阅读理解ManualResetEvent,以及如何使用。官方说明官方介绍:https://docs.microsoft.com/en-us/dotnet/api/system.threading.manualresetevent?view=netframework-1.1一个线程同步事件 ,通过发信号来控制线程来控制 是否有权限访问 资源构造函数初始化实例,并且指明信号的初始状态 ...

2019-07-21 23:47:30 106

原创 如何画数据流图

快速阅读如何画数据流图,以及如何在visio2013中画数据流图。数据流图中各个园元分别代表什么含义。什么是数据流图DFD=data flow diagram在系统设计阶段。是对将来要构建的系统提取一个逻辑模型的过程 。关注点是过程内数据的处理标识图元有四个 ,分别是实体,过程,数据流,数据存储可以逐步求精,先画顶层数据流图,再到分层以数据流图,最后可以形成数据字典和底动数据流图常...

2019-07-21 00:05:37 2142

原创 如何画好ER图

快速阅读了解ER图的基本组成,以及如何在viso中画ER图。什么是ER图是实体关系图,用矩形表示实体,用椭圆形表示属性,用棱形表示两实体之间的联系。相互用直接联接起来,是一种数据建模工具。用来描述现实世界的概念模型 。怎么画,用什么工具画最常见是用VISIO来画,也可以在线网站Processon里画。实体矩形表示 。内写明实名名属性用椭圆形表示,用直接与实体连接联系用菱形...

2019-07-19 23:14:04 1222

原创 如何画好时序图

UML图中时序图的基本用法快速阅读序列图主要用来更直观的表现各个对象交互的时间顺序,将体现的重点放在 以时间为参照,各个对象发送、接收消息,处理消息,返回消息的 时间流程顺序,也称为时序图。里面用到的基本元素如下:角色-可以是人,其它系统或子系统对象 -交互的主体,接受发送消息的主体,生命线角色和对象下面垂直的虚线。代表角色和对象在一段时间类存在。激活对象操作执行时期,处于激...

2019-07-18 23:39:03 2312

原创 系统架构设计上需要注意的

系统架构设计上需要注意的快速阅读如何保证系统的防重放和不可抵赖性。 socket 长连接和短连接,tuxedo和webloigc的平台架构以及这两者之间如何进行通讯。nh结尾的文献资料用什么打开。要保证系统的防重放机制防重放就是利用fd等工具把原有的请求再原封不动的再发送一次或多次。这个业务逻辑属于正常 ,但是可能会造成数据库数据的复复。采用md5(时间戳方式+random(0,1000...

2019-07-17 23:28:17 221

原创 weblogic简单介绍

快速阅读介绍weblogic中间件,以及自身架构和几个基本概念,如何下载,安装等后面再详细介绍 。什么是weblogicWebLogic最早由 WebLogic Inc. 开发,后并入BEA 公司,最终BEA公司又并入Oracle公司webserver是用来构建网站的必要软件,具有解析、发布网页等功能,它是用纯java开发的参考:https://baike.baidu.com/item/...

2019-07-16 23:46:37 6299

原创 Tuxedo中间件调研

快速阅读介绍Tuxedo,以及webLogic两个中间件,都是oracle旗下的产品 ,现在各银行系统用的最多。因为有部分项目涉及,所以有必须弄清楚,明白 。什么是Tu...

2019-07-14 23:25:52 259

原创 c# winform如何异步不卡界面

快速阅读如何在winform程序中,让界面不再卡死。关于委托和AsyncCallback的使用。界面卡死的原因是因为耗时任务的计算占用了主线程,导致主界面没有办法进行其它...

2019-07-13 22:56:22 2771

转载 银行代销系统调研

快速阅读因为项目需要,调研并记录一下银行代销系统的架构,记录以备忘 。图片比较多,但都是精华。需要慢慢品尝。基金业务原则基金管理公司是基金管理人。负责基金的投资动作。银行...

2019-07-12 23:48:50 1267 1

原创 WCF中如何用nettcp协议进行通讯

快速阅读如何在wcf中用net tcp协议进行通讯,一个打开Wcf的公共类。比较好好,可以记下来。配置文件中注意配置 Service,binding,behaviors....

2019-07-11 22:51:48 789

原创 如何用控制台启动一个wcf服务

快速阅读如何用控制台启动一个wcf服务,已经wcf的配置和在类库中如何实现 。wcf类库用vs新建一个类库,引用system.ServiceModel定义接口实现服务契约...

2019-07-10 23:22:21 396

原创 WCF必知必会以及与Webapi的区别

快速阅读介绍wcf中的信息交换模式MEP以及数据在传输过程中的序列化,endpont的介绍和wcf的三种实例模式以及安全模式 以及和Webapi的简单对比wcf介绍支持跨...

2019-07-09 22:41:44 1500 1

原创 2019年7月第一周总结-RabbitMQ总结

快速阅读RabbitMq的介绍以及环境安装配置,以及RabbitMq的六种应用 。单生产者和消费者,单生产者多消费者,消息的发布订阅,消息类型Echange中的Direc...

2019-07-08 21:57:00 79

原创 RabbitMQ入门学习系列(六) Exchange的Topic类型

快速阅读介绍exchange的topic类型,和Direct类型相似,但是增加了".“和”#"的匹配。比Direct类型灵活Topic消息类型特点是:topic消息类型不能是任意的routing key, 必须是有点"."组成的单词列表。和dirct类似,最后也是也相应的key进行匹配例如:speed.color.sepcies注意可以用*号和#号出现,和我们日常用的正则表达式含义相近...

2019-07-07 23:40:41 572

原创 RabbitMQ入门学习系列(五) Exchange的Direct类型

快速阅读利用Exchange的Direct类型,实现对队列的过滤,消费者启动以后,输入相应的key值,攻取该key值对应的在队列中的消息 。从一节知道Exchange有四种类型Direct,Topic,headers,fanout前面我们说了fanout类型,可以把消息发送给所有的消费者,在用Fanout类型的时候,我们绑定的时候是没有指定Routing key的【空值】 chann...

2019-07-06 11:43:01 77

原创 RabbitMQ入门学习系列(六) Exchange的Topic类型

快速阅读介绍exchange的topic类型,和Direct类型相似,但是增加了"."和"#"的匹配。比Direct类型灵活Topic消息类型特点是:topic消息类型不...

2019-07-06 11:28:10 81

原创 RabbitMQ入门学习系列(五) Exchange的Direct类型

快速阅读利用Exchange的Direct类型,实现对队列的过滤,消费者启动以后,输入相应的key值,攻取该key值对应的在队列中的消息 。从一节知道Exchange有四...

2019-07-05 15:08:07 82

原创 RabbitMQ入门学习系列(四) 发布订阅模式

什么时发布订阅模式把消息发送给多个订阅者。也就是有多个消费端都完整的接收生产者的消息换句话说 把消息广播给多个消费者消息模型的核心RabbitMQ不发送消息给队列,生产者...

2019-07-04 15:26:07 61

原创 RabbitMQ入门学习系列(三).消息发送接收

快速阅读 用Rabitmq的队列管理,以及如何保证消息在队列中不丢失。通过ack的消息确认和持久化进行操作。以及Rabbit中如何用Web面板进行管理队列。消费者如何处理...

2019-07-03 22:27:47 86

原创 RabbitMQ入门学习系列(二),单生产者消费者

友情提示 我对我的文章负责,发现好多网上的文章 没有实践,都发出来的,让人走很多弯路,如果你在我的文章中遇到无法实现,或者无法走通的问题。可以直接在公众号《爱码农爱生活 ...

2019-07-02 21:19:09 63

原创 RabbitMQ简介

RabbitMQ是一种消息队列 ,用于常见的进程通信。支持点对点,请求应答和发布订阅模式 并且提供多种语言的支持。常见的java,c#,php都支持。常被...

2019-07-01 23:51:46 66

原创 EasyTrader踩坑之旅总结

easytrader是用python写的可以调用主要券商完成自动化炒股的一个软件 ,但我用的是同花顺,在研究过程中,发现同花顺暂时调不通。后来搜索发现thstrade的源码作者说是easytrader对同花顺已经不能调用成功 。所以之后改为thstrader的研究。最终实现了查余额,查持仓,卖出股票,买入股票的总结一下踩坑过程中遇到的问题1. No module named win32ap...

2019-06-30 18:02:50 2027

原创 EasyTrader踩坑之旅(三)

快速阅读用THSTrader 调试同花顺自动下单的过程 。主要原理是利用python函数pywinauto 自动获取同花顺上相应控件的值,进行模拟自动化的操作,不得不说python函数库的强大,其它语言非常也能做到。但是复杂度远远高于python,这个也是python变的越来流行的原因了。所以现在数学专业抢码农的工作是挺好抢的。利用esseract ocr进行券商验证码的识别,不过没有正式用起...

2019-06-29 16:51:24 1400 2

原创 Easytrader踩坑之旅(二)

快速阅读用的是THSTrader进行的调试,同花须必须用8.0的。在新的机子重新安装requirements已经调用同花顺查股票余额。继续昨天的话题。昨天到最后,虽然显示...

2019-06-28 23:32:23 740

原创 Easytrader踩坑之旅(一)

快速阅读 主要是安装easytrader过程中踩到的一个又一个坑以及换到thstrade后的一个又一个坑,到处都是坑,坑无极限坑无止境。 本以为easytrader直接p...

2019-06-27 17:43:58 4836

原创 python在windows平台的多版本配置

快速阅读: python在windows平台的环境变量以及多版本配置 ,以及pycharm如何安装包,以及安装包出错时如何排查。1.python环境变量官网下载:http...

2019-06-26 17:27:45 390

原创 mybatis-generator-gui 如何exe化

快速阅读:用wix和inno setup把mybatis-generator-gui 打包成exe和安装文件。以后使用的时候方便,不用每次打开eclipse运行。使用inno setup 5 和wix 3.11基于mybatis generator开发一款界面工具, 非常容易及快速生成Mybatis的Java POJO文件及数据库Mapping文件。官方:https://gite...

2019-06-25 17:34:04 611

原创 LPVOID是一个没有类型的指针

LPVOID是一个没有类型的指针,也就是说你可以将任意类型的指针赋值给LPVOID类型的变量(一般作为参数传递),然后在使用的时候再转换回来。可以将其理解为long型的指针,指向void型。2示例程序编辑class CMyClass{void Start();static UINT StartThread(LPVOID lParam);};void CM...

2014-09-04 13:06:33 176

原创 HRESULT是什么,应该如何理解

句柄的由来[1] windows 之所以要设立句柄,根本上源于内存管理机制的问题—虚拟地址,简而言之数据的地址需要变动,变动以后就需要有人来记录管理变动,(就好像户籍管理一样),因此系统用句柄来记载数据地址的变更。数据对象加载进入内存中之后即获得了地址,但是这个地址并不是固定的,(至于为什么以及什么情况下变动具体需要大家研究虚拟地址的原理与机制我这里只提我确定知道的例子)数据对象会根据需...

2014-09-04 10:20:54 157

原创 HRESULT是什么,应该如何理解

句柄的由来[1] windows 之所以要设立句柄,根本上源于内存管理机制的问题—虚拟地址,简而言之数据的地址需要变动,变动以后就需要有人来记录管理变动,(就好像户籍管理一样),因此系统用句柄来记载数据地址的变更。数据对象加载进入内存中之后即获得了地址,但是这个地址并不是固定的,(至于为什么以及什么情况下变动具体需要大家研究虚拟地址的原理与机制我这里只提我确定知道的例子)数据对象会根据需...

2014-09-04 10:20:39 235

原创 HRESULT是什么,应该如何理解

长时间进行Windows编程的人一定对HRESULT特别熟悉,因为HRESULT作为一种函数的返回值类型曝光率实在太高了,可是你是否知道HRESULT到底是什么?为什么不直接使用简洁又亲切的BOOL作为函数的返回值类型呢?    单从名字上看,HRESULT似乎是指向函数结果的句柄,但是这种直观地猜想却是错误的。其实HRESULT的意义非常简单,它不是Handle to Result而是Her...

2014-09-04 09:53:15 813

原创 两款cpu型号【E7400VSe8400】的对比。

参数仅为参考,产品以当地实际销售实物为准。隐藏相同参数只显示我点击过的hot型号Intel 酷睿2双核 E8400(盒)Intel 酷睿2双核 E7400(盒)请选择品牌IntelAMD请选择型号请选择品牌请选择型号←×→←×→←×→←×→报价...

2014-06-27 14:26:46 1693

原创 DOS批处理中%cd%和%~dp0的区别

DOS批处理中%cd%和%~dp0的区别 在DOS的批处理中,有时候需要知道当前的路径。在DOS中,有两个环境变量可以跟当前路径有关,一个是%cd%, 一个是%~dp0。     这两个变量的用法和代表的内容是不同的。     1. %cd% 可以用在批处理文件中,也可以用在命令行中;展开后,是驱动器盘符:+当前目录,如在dos窗口中进入c:\dir目录下面,  www.2...

2014-06-24 08:42:25 126

原创 ASP.NET MVC SSO单点登录设计与实现

 实验环境配置HOST文件配置如下:127.0.0.1 app.com127.0.0.1 sso.comIIS配置如下:应用程序池采用.Net Framework 4.0注意IIS绑定的域名,两个完全不同域的域名。app.com网站配置如下:  sso.com网站配置如下:memcached缓存: 数据库配置: 数据库采用Entity...

2014-06-22 22:55:28 144

AccessDatabaseEngine.rar

sqlyog插件AccessDatabaseEnginesqlyog插件AccessDatabaseEngine

2020-05-11

CodeSmith教程

CodeSmith教程 CodeSmith教程 CodeSmith教程

2010-01-28

c# 简繁体转换 小功能

简繁体转换简繁体转换简繁体转换简繁体转换

2009-04-28

petshop打印注释版,

petshop打印注释版,petshop4.0 vs2005<br>可以与我交流,希望一起学习,共同提高,<br>QQ 672464535<br>

2007-12-21

jscript 参考

查询语法,对于在网站编程的时候帮助非常大

2007-11-08

Asp.Net技术文档

Asp.Net技术文档

2007-09-12

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除